Trip: Snoqualmie Pass - Kendall Circumnavigation

 

Date: 1/28/2012

 

Trip Report:

Friends and I have been talking about skiing on the north side of Kendall for some time. Maps and pictures make the skiing look good. Then again you have to spend a bit of time in upper Silver Creek, or the Kendall Peak avalanche firing line.

 

We checked out an entry point one day, but thick clouds made visibility sketchy. Finally I saw a nice day with a lower avalanche potential. Cman and I decided to ski it on Saturday. Without fail NOAA forecasts started going downhill.

 

When we left the parking lot we figured we could lap the south slopes if things got worse.

When we reached the ridgeline we could see clouds dropping and the wind picked up

Our bad weather backup plan for skiing out Gold Creek generated some laughs. After a couple minutes talking about wind and clouds we decided to go for it.

Snow in Silver Creek basin was nice. A little wind packed but not bad.

After a nice ski in Silver Basin we started climbing back towards Commonwealth Basin. There was no wind in Silver Creek Basin, but you could see it blowing on top of Kendall.

We made the ridgeline and looked at the top of Kendall.

If it wasn't so windy summiting Kendall would be easy, but we figured it was time to get the hell out of Dodge.

The snow near the top of the ridge was nice, but it eventually turned to Cascade cement.

As always lot of folks on the trail lower down with the skiing version of the game Frogger. We timed things out nicely. It started raining after we were in the car.

Approach Notes:

Windblown powder and ice near ridgelines
